36. An ignorant person does
attain liberation through activity by way
of repeated practice. The blessed one,
through mere Knowledge, stands free,
devoid of all activities.
[¹ Devoid etc.-When Self-knowledge is attained,
all physical and mental activities come to an end,
because they are the outcome of ignorance.]

37. The ignorant person does not
attain to Brahman for he desires to become
It. The wise one surely realizes the nature
of the Supreme Brahman even without
desiring it.
